相关文章
Batch Normalization (BN) 和 Synchronized Batch Normalization (SyncBN) 的区别
Batch Normalization 和 Synchronized Batch Normalization 的区别 Batch Normalization (BN) 和 Synchronized Batch Normalization (SyncBN) 的区别1. BN(Batch Normalization)2. SyncBN(Synchronized Batch Normalization)3. 选…
建站知识
2025/2/17 8:46:37
如何在Node.js中使用中间件处理请求
Node.js作为一种基于事件驱动、非阻塞I/O模型的运行环境,广泛用于构建高性能的Web应用。在Node.js中,处理中间件是处理HTTP请求和响应的一个常见方式,特别是在使用Express框架时,中间件扮演着至关重要的角色。本文将介绍如何在Nod…
建站知识
2025/2/23 0:33:21
【Python深入浅出】Python3正则表达式:开启高效字符串处理大门
目录 一、正则表达式基础入门1.1 什么是正则表达式1.2 正则表达式的语法规则1.3 特殊字符与转义 二、Python 中的 re 模块2.1 re 模块概述2.2 常用函数与方法2.2.1 re.match()2.2.2 re.search()2.2.3 re.findall()2.2.4 re.sub() 2.3 修饰符(Flags)的使用…
建站知识
2025/2/17 23:56:23
RESTful API 和 WebSocket 的区别
文章目录 1. RESTful API特点使用场景示例 2. WebSocket特点使用场景示例 3. RESTful API 和 WebSocket 对比总结4. 哪种方式适合大模型服务?RESTful APIWebSocket 5. 什么时候用 REST?什么时候用 WebSocket?6. 结论 RESTful API 和 WebSocke…
建站知识
2025/2/16 14:38:24
cuda compact data
实现 并行压缩(Compaction) 操作,主要用于从输入数组 d_input 中筛选出满足某个条件的元素(由 predicate 逻辑判断),并将这些元素紧凑地存储到 d_output 数组中,去除不满足条件的元素࿰…
建站知识
2025/2/18 13:23:10
Git 与持续集成 / 持续部署(CI/CD)的集成
一、引言
在当今快速发展的软件开发领域,高效的代码管理和持续的交付流程是项目成功的关键因素。Git 作为一款分布式版本控制系统,已经成为了开发者们管理代码的标配工具;而持续集成 / 持续部署(CI/CD)则是一种能够加…
建站知识
2025/2/17 3:08:38
关于Java项目集群部署的概述
对于Java项目而言,集群部署更是不可或缺的一环。本文将详细介绍Java项目集群部署的步骤和注意事项,帮助您更好地将Java应用部署到集群环境中。 一、集群部署概述
集群部署是指将多个服务器或计算节点组合在一起,共同承担用户请求,…
建站知识
2025/2/22 2:47:46